I managed to build a circuit that allows the use of user defined characters instead of the default chargen rom.
It is known running with CBM 3032 but should soon run run with 8096 / 8296 too.
Visit http://home.germany.net/nils.eilers/chargen (http://home.germany.net/nils.eilers/chargen) and see some pictures etc.
It comes with a font editor that even runs if you don't have the hardware. All you need is at least 2 KB RAM at $9000.
